Responsibilities
  • Electrical System Design
    • Design and develop electrical architectures for UUVs, AUVs, ROVs, subsea payloads, and related support equipment.
    • Develop power distribution systems, battery interfaces, motor control electronics, embedded control boards, sensor interfaces, communication buses, and data acquisition systems.
    • Create schematics, PCB layouts, cable drawings, wiring diagrams, interface control documents, and electrical design documentation.
    • Select components for subsea and high-reliability applications, including connectors, penetrators, batteries, sensors, embedded processors, power converters, and communication modules.
  • Undersea Electronics & Integration
    • Integrate electronics into pressure housings, subsea enclosures, wet-mate interfaces, and vehicle hull structures.
    • Support design considerations related to pressure, corrosion, galvanic isolation, thermal management, sealing, shock, vibration, and long-duration underwater operation.
    • Develop and troubleshoot interfaces for sonar, acoustic modems, inertial navigation systems, depth sensors, Doppler velocity logs, cameras, payload sensors, thrusters, and mission computers.
    • Support electrical integration of autonomous vehicle subsystems, including propulsion, navigation, control, communications, payloads, and energy storage.
